Show Thursday, September 9, 2004 SPRINGVILLE HERALD 11 OBITUARY Lorraine II Davies Lorraine Riley Davies passed away September 3, 2004 in St. George, Utah. She was born October 9, 1923 in ; Goshen, Utah to John T. and ; Sadie Lewis Riley. She mar-: mar-: ried LaVar H. Davies August Au-gust 29, 1942 in Ogden, Utah. Their marriage was later solemnized sol-emnized in the Manti IDS Temple. '. Her early years were ; spent in Goshen, after which her family moved to Spanish Fork, Utah where she re-; re-; ceived her education, graduating gradu-ating from Spanish Fork ; High School She later ! moved with her parents to Ogden, Utah where she ; worked as a secretary at the 'Ogden Army Supply Depot. ' She met her husband at a ; church social, and later sup-; sup-; ported him as he served in the Navy during World War II. After the war they lived in Provo, Orem, and finally ' settled down in Springville where they resided for over fifty years. Lorraine was a faithful member of the Church of Jesus Je-sus Christ of Latter-day Saints, serving in the primary prima-ry and relief society for many years, as well as in the Provo Temple as an ordinance ordi-nance worker. Lorraine was an accom-- accom-- plished knitter, quilter, and ceramist. Her handiwork is treasured by friends and . family. She was a loved .mother, grandmother, great-grandmother great-grandmother and friend to all.
